Robert Hunter has added even more dates to his upcoming run. The former Grateful Dead lyricist will kick off the series of shows at The Paramount in Huntington, NY on September 26 before making his way across the Northeast for a short tour that will wrap up with a performance at New York City’s Town Hall on October 10. A full list of his upcoming dates can be found below.

Hunter has only made sporadic live appearances during the past two decades. Most notably, he performed at New York’s Wetlands closing night in 2001 and supported The Dead on select shows between 2002-2004. Since his last support spot with The Dead on August 8, 2004, he’s written with the likes of Bob Dylan, Jim Lauderdale, Little Feat, Papa Mali and the surviving members of the Grateful Dead, among others.
